Saved Contact List
The Saved Contact List allows you to save details of people or accounts you regularly send money to. Once added, their information will be available whenever you make a transfer - no need to retype their IBAN or name.
Benefits:
- Faster repeat transfers: choose from your saved contacts and send money in just a few clicks.
- Fewer errors: select from verified, pre-saved details instead of typing them each time.
- Easy to manage: add, edit, or remove contacts whenever needed to keep your list up to date.
Note: in some countries, this is called a beneficiary list. In Germany and across Europe, the term recipient is more commonly used.
Instant SEPA Transfers
Expatrio supports Instant SEPA Transfers, allowing you to send and receive money within seconds to any SEPA (Single Euro Payments Area) bank account.
Instant transfers are:
- Available 24/7, including weekends and public holidays
- Processed immediately, so funds arrive almost instantly
- Secure, following the SEPA network standards for European payments
- Free of charge
Note: availability may depend on your recipient’s bank supporting SEPA Instant payments.
How to Make a Transfer
Follow these steps to make a transfer using your saved contacts or to send an instant SEPA payment:
- Go to the Banking tab in your account.
- In the Transfer Money section, select Add a New Contact.
- Enter the recipient’s name, IBAN, and country, then submit - the contact will be saved.
- Scroll or search to select a saved contact; their details will auto-fill in the transfer form.
- Enter the transfer amount and reference note.
- Review the details and confirm the transfer.
- Successful transfers will appear in the Recent Transfers section.
- Manage contacts - you can edit or remove saved contacts at any time.
- To make an instant transfer, simply select “Instant Transfer” when you get to the “Review Transfer” screen.
Troubleshooting and Support
If your transfer doesn’t go through instantly, it may be because your recipient’s bank does not yet support SEPA Instant transfers. The payment will be processed as a regular SEPA transfer instead.
